Abstract :
The present contribution reports investigations on the metal-ligand bond lengths and interaction energies in selected carbon monoxide complexes of metal cations sharing the ns2np0 valence configuration. 1- and 4-component DFT geometry optimizations have been performed for cations ranging from Ge2+ to Uuq2+, the dication of element 114 (Ununquadium). The nature of the bonding has been studied by means of energy decomposition analysis.
